**Ticket PKT-88: Webhook fires twice on parcel handoff**

For whoever inherits this: the Cartwheel parcel-tracking webhook double-fires when a package moves from the Delven hub to a courier within the same minute. Downstream, Merrow's notifier then texts customers twice. Root cause looks like a missing idempotency check in the handoff event coalescer. Repro steps attached. The offending deploy is identified by the token below.

trace token, hawep-hadug: htk3_9c2

Torrentix websockets support per-message deflate, but we disable it on the mobile gateway: compression saves roughly 30% bandwidth while doubling CPU on small frames, which dominates our traffic. Maintainers changing this tradeoff should benchmark with the replay harness first. The harness connects to the gateway using an auth credential read from its environment. Before running it, add this line to the harness env file.

env line for yahag-kajog: VAULT_KEY13=e1c568d90102d

**Runbook: Account Recovery — Flaky DNS on Vellum Gate**

New folks: when recovering locked accounts on Vellum Gate, the resolver occasionally returns stale records for the auth pool. Retry the lookup twice, waiting ten seconds between attempts, before escalating. If resolution succeeds, proceed to unlock the account via the Quillbridge console. To authorize the unlock, enter the passphrase exactly as shown below.

unlock words, kagef-taduf: fenir-quenix-norwyn-sorvan-gormir-gorir-fraok

**Mgmt Meeting Minutes — Retiring the Brightline Range**

Quick recap for sales leads at Fenholt Supplies: we agreed to retire the Brightline fixture range by year-end. Remaining stock moves to clearance pricing next month, and accounts on standing orders get migrated to the Lumetta range. Trade-in incentives were approved in principle. The confidential note on next steps sits just below.

board note of bajof-bajeg: The pricing group signed off on a budget of $13.4 million for Project Sildor. The renewal with Lamixek Holdings closes at $48.9 million a year, 49 percent above the last contract.